Things change a lot in 30 years! When I first started going to the land we bought from my mother-in-law, I could see a knoll, 1/4 mile off the road, where our house now sits. Today, I can't even see the house from the road, even in the winter. Several trees, mostly box elder and elm have grown up. The understory is gray dogwood thickets, a few crab apples, sassafras, popple, ash, wild rose and a handful of oaks on the drier ground. I started cutting the big trees and plan to use the tops for ready-made brush piles. The elm I can use for a base for other brush piles as it is very rot resistant. Having the canopy reduced will encourage berry canes to sprout. All good stuff for rabbits.
